This exceptional investment opportunity presents a 98,125-square-foot multi-tenant warehouse located at 28241 Mound Rd, Warren, MI 48092, in Macomb County. Built in 1988 and renovated in 2008, this property sits on an 8.26-acre lot and boasts a substantial 2024 estimated Net Operating Income (NOI) of $573,600. Currently 70% occupied, the building features three tenants, with the largest, Cort Furniture, occupying the majority of the space. The average remaining lease term is five years, providing immediate and long-term income potential. The warehouse offers 11 loading docks and 4 dock-high doors, along with impressive ceiling heights ranging from 28 to 30 feet. Significant expansion potential exists, with room to add over 50,000 square feet. The property includes 44,473 square feet of office space and robust power capabilities of 1,600 amps at 480 volts.
